Crunchyroll licensed the series. It aired from January 9 to March 27, 2022, on Tokyo MX and other networks. The series is directed by Shinmei Kawahara, with Ohine Ezaki writing the series' scripts. Each of these Lantern Corps also has their own oath, and while these oaths do not differ from species to species, they are altered to reflect the drives of each Corps. However, the idea of varying oaths found its way into the variety of Lantern Corps that proliferated in the leadup to the Blackest Night each color had its own emotional drive, such as yellow for fear and indigo for compassion. Unfortunately, this development has been overlooked in recent years, with everyone taking the same oath. Despite the differences in oaths, each still had its own rhythm and flow, just like the original. With this in mind, the oath differing from species to species makes sense, reflecting a more grounded take on the Green Lantern mythos. The members of the Green Lantern Corps speak many different languages, each with their own vocabulary and grammar.
